Phil had a career in industry until the age of thirty. However, the experience of learning meditation as a teenager and several years of martial arts training had set the seeds of a developing inquiry into the mysteries and intricacies of what it takes to become a really human being. In 1989 a bang on the head brought Phil to the attention of the local McTimoney Chiropractor, after which things were never quite the same.
Phil graduated from the McTimoney College in Oxford in 1992 and started practice in Duffield, Ashbourne and Lichfield. When the Woodlands Centre opened in 1993, Phil focused his practice into the Derby area.
Later on in 1993, the experience of a Zero Balancing session revealed the next part of the path. Phil pursued Zero Balancing training in England and America, becoming a Certified Zero Balancer in 1997, and subsequently a Certified Teacher of Zero Balancing.
Phil's practice is now entitled 'Core Alignment Therapy' which brings together all of the strands of his experience in movement, bodywork and meditation.
